This position is designed for individuals who are looking for new tasks, to advance their knowledge, and take responsibility for their safe work behavior and the safety of their coworkers. The tasks include but are not limited to: grain receiving, storage handling, drying, blending, and loading of grain; monitoring stored grain condition and maintaining and cleaning grain facilities and equipment to provide a safe environment. Grain Elevator Operators will be cross-trained to perform a variety of tasks including driving trucks and other motorized equipment.
